How much do senior performance test eng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for senior performance test engineer in Quebec is $131,303.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$99,500.00 and $163,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Senior Performance Test Engineers?

Senior Performance Test Engineers are specialized professionals responsible for designing, executing, and analyzing performance tests to ensure software applications meet required speed, scalability, and stability standards. They identify system bottlenecks, recommend improvements, and collaborate with development and operations teams to optimize application performance. With years of experience, they often lead performance testing strategies, mentor junior testers, and use advanced tools to simulate high-stress scenarios. Their work ensures that applications can handle expected user loads and perform reliably under various conditions.

The main difference between a Senior Performance Test Engineer and a Performance Test Engineer lies in experience, responsibilities, and leadership. Senior professionals typically lead testing efforts, mentor team members, and handle complex performance challenges, while Performance Test Engineers focus on executing tests and supporting the testing process. Both roles require similar certifications and work in comparable environments, but the senior role involves more strategic and leadership duties.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Senior Performance Test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Senior Performance Test Engineer, you need advanced knowledge of software testing methodologies, scripting languages, and a degree in computer science or a related field. Expertise in tools like JMeter, LoadRunner, or Gatling and familiarity with CI/CD pipelines are typically required, along with relevant certifications such as ISTQB. Strong analytical thinking, problem-solving skills, and effective communication set top performers apart in this role. These skills and qualifications are vital to accurately assess system performance, identify bottlenecks, and ensure robust, scalable applications.

What are some common challenges faced by Senior Performance Test Engineers when working on large-scale applications?

Senior Performance Test Engineers often encounter challenges such as accurately simulating real-world user loads, identifying bottlenecks in complex, distributed environments, and ensuring test data and environments closely mirror production. Collaborating with development and operations teams to resolve performance issues can also be demanding, especially when root causes are not immediately apparent. Staying current with evolving tools and best practices is essential to effectively address these challenges and deliver reliable, high-performing applications.
